Frequently Asked Questions

Is Melbourne cheaper than Austin?

Melbourne is cheaper than Austin. Melbourne has a cost of living index of 48/100 compared to 55/100 for Austin (New York = 100), making it roughly 12% more affordable overall.

How much cheaper is Melbourne than Austin?

Melbourne is approximately 12% cheaper than Austin based on cost index scores (48 vs 55, where New York = 100). A person spending $3,000/month in Austin could live a similar lifestyle for roughly $2,633/month in Melbourne.

What is the rent comparison between Melbourne and Austin?

In Melbourne, a 1-bedroom apartment in the city center costs approximately $1,785/month. In Austin, the equivalent is around $1,650/month.

Which city is better for digital nomads — Melbourne or Austin?

Both cities have nomad infrastructure. Melbourne offers 70 Mbps internet and coworking at ~$240/month. Austin offers 200 Mbps and coworking at ~$350/month. Melbourne has a cost advantage of 12%.

What is the average income in Melbourne vs Austin?

The median net monthly salary in Melbourne is approximately $4,100 USD, compared to $5,417 USD in Austin.
